click through the next articleDo something separate for the individuals exactly where you work. Which includes as well numerous folks from your workplace can expand your guest list substantially. They most likely don't know your household, anyway, so they might really feel awkward showing up and trying to fit in. Instead, have cake or snacks in the lunchroom or go out for drinks (arrange to have designated drivers) right after function one particular day and invite any person you like or just announce it normally and let men and women make a decision for themselves no matter whether to join you. This offers everyone a likelihood to celebrate and meet you whilst maintaining your wedding a tiny a lot more intimate.

Know that venue matters a lot more than any other point when budgeting a wedding. The average US wedding charges $25,000, but virtually $11,000 of that is spent on the venue and food. 9 You need to think about where you are having your wedding before anything else or you might end up with quite small of your spending budget to devote on, entertainment, decorations, invites, and so on.

As you generate a schedule of what you will be performing throughout the day, make sure you block out time for consuming. For example, if your ceremony is in the morning and your reception isn't until the evening, you must program to eat anything quickly right after your ceremony.
